v-for中的key问题
在一个页面产生很多个v-for时应该保持key的独一无二不然会出现一下情况
vue控制台报错Duplicate keys detected: ‘xxxx‘. This may cause an update error.
目前加字符串可以完美解决
但是有可能随着层级的加深出现渲染问题
Error in render: "TypeError: Cannot read properties of undefined (reading 'name')" found in....
意思就是模板在渲染时候,读取对象中的某个对象的属性值时,这个对象不存在,说通俗点就是三层表达式a.b.c,在对象a中没有对象b,那么读取对象a.b.c中的值,自然会报错。如果是两层表达式a.b则不会报错,返回的是undefined
【解决方案】:
在上面一个div中或者再当前添加v-if判断条件,如果queryData[0]取不到,则不加载该div即可解决。(注意,不能用v-show,v-show的机制是加载后,根据条件判断是否显示)
v-for中的key问题相关推荐
- PHP 如何获取二维数组中某个key的集合(高性能查找)
分享下PHP 获取二维数组中某个key的集合的方法. 具体是这样的,如下一个二维数组,是从库中读取出来的. 代码: $user = array( 0 => array( 'id' => 1 ...
- oracle v rman status,RMAN 中V$ARCHIVED_LOG 中STATUS 为X 的文件处理
记录一下[@more@] 今天发现RMAN 中V$ARCHIVED_LOG 中STATUS 为"X" 的文件,想起是因为手动删掉错几个日志造成的,通过如下的方法把RMAN 中的记录 ...
- 如何判断Map中的key或value是什么类型
对于某些从泛型(比如:Map<K, V>)中继承过来的数据,K可能是String.Integer.等等.如果需要map.get(key),得先确保key的类型跟map的K匹配. 对于key ...
- hashmap中的key是有序的么_美团面试题:Hashmap结构,1.7和1.8有哪些区别(史上最最详细解析)...
作者|依本多情 原文:blog.csdn.net/qq_36520235/article/details/82417949 一.真实面试题之:Hashmap的结构,1.7和1.8有哪些区别 不同点: ...
- php 数组 改变key,如何修改php数组中的key
如何修改php数组中的key 发布时间:2020-08-01 14:49:52 来源:亿速云 阅读:105 作者:清晨 小编给大家分享一下如何修改php数组中的key,希望大家阅读完这篇文章后大所收获 ...
- 关于v$process与v$session中process的理解
v$session有个process字段,V$PROCESS有个SPID字段,这两个字段是不是一个意思呢?是不是都代表会话的操作系统进程呢? 官方文档上的解释: SPID VARCHAR2( ...
- 如果要将对象用作Map中的key,需要注意什么
点击上方"方志朋",选择"置顶公众号" 技术文章第一时间送达! 本文阅读时间大约5分钟. 参考答案 如果将对象作为Map中的key,需要是实现该对象的equal ...
- oracle中key,mysql中的key在oracle中是什么
mysql中的key在oracle中是什么 说明一下.key在oracle中对应的是什么? 比如说: CREATE TABLE `AdBanner` ( `BannerId` int(8) NOT N ...
- oracle设置缓存大小设置多少,【数据库类※从V$DB_CACHE_ADVICE中设置数据缓冲大小※】...
[数据库类※从V$DB_CACHE_ADVICE中设置数据缓冲大小※] Oracle 9i引入了一个新的途径来预测数据缓冲cache中附加数据缓存的所带来的好处的多少.V$DB_CACHE_A ...
- MySQL create table语法中的key与index的区别
在create table的语句中,key和index混淆在一起,官方手册中的解释是这样: KEY is normally a synonym for INDEX. The key attribute ...
最新文章
- UML2.0工具比較
- 自学成才翁_作为一名自学成才的开发者从“我的旅程”中吸取的教训
- mysql的bean配置_jsp+tomcat+mysql+sevlet+javabean配置流程
- matlab pca求曲率和法向量_实践课堂 已给出实例的MATLAB求解大汇总(线性规划)...
- 硬件:如何选购适合自己的显示器
- Angular Redux
- 在Eclipse中如何操作zookpeer
- thttpd源码解析 定时器模块
- elastic search与mysql的数据同步
- c语言教程 萌萌哒,本人C语言小白,帮我解释每段代码的意思。谢了萌萌哒
- js跨域的各种方法总结。
- java的泛,java_泛型
- 《数据结构与抽象:Java语言描述(原书第4版)》一Java插曲1
- oracle vfp,VFP如何连SQL Server及Oracle
- iOS:下载/创建证书
- 推荐免费下载380套大型商业源码
- 印刷质量缺陷的视觉检测原理概述
- 智能辅助系统在配电站所内的建设及应用
- 酷炫的迁徙图和轮播图,用pyecharts也可以做出来
- Yasm入门-hello world